Damages
The most common damages that result from boating accidents are medical expenses as well as lost income and pain and suffering. The severity of your injuries will determine the amount you could receive in a settlement or jury verdict. The amount of catastrophic injuries that include traumatic brain injury or spinal cord injury or permanent disfigurement, are usually more.
Medical expenses may include hospital bills, ambulance fees, doctor's visits, physical therapy, medications and other associated expenses. Your lawyer will establish the past and future medical expenses. In certain states, you could also be awarded compensation for future losses due to your injuries. These could include costs for the services of a home health aid or additional physical therapy appointments as well as loss of future earning capability.

Expert Witnesses
In any personal injury case, having a network of experts who can provide testimony is the best way to support an claim for compensation. Eyewitnesses can be helpful in proving that the accident occurred expert witnesses have special qualifications that make them credible experts in their matter. They are paid for their opinion, and they can be an enormous amount of credibility to an investigation.
A expert witness in marine engineering for instance, can recreate the technological events that caused a boating crash by studying evidence such as speed calculations and collisions caused by visibility. They can also testify as to the safety rules that were adhered to, or if any were not.
A medical professional is an important expert witness. They can testify on the severity of your injuries, and their long-term implications. They can also describe how your life will change because of them, which can impact the amount of damages you can claim.
Admiralty and maritime expert witnesses can perform forensic investigations of the causes of accidents involving recreational boats and personal watercrafts, as commercial vessels and their crew. They also can provide evidence and analysis of maritime law which govern ship classification, surveying and design.
